Summary:
"The story of the enigmatic founder of the
Rolling
Stones
and the early years of the band.
Brian
Jones
was the golden boy of the
Rolling
Stones
, the visionary who gave the band its name and its sound. Yet he was a haunted man, and much of his brief time with the band, before his death in 1969 at the infamous age of twenty-seven, was volatile and tragic. Some of the details of how
Jones
was dethroned are well known, but the full story is still largely untold. A forensic account of
Jones
's life, detailing his pioneering achievements and messy unraveling. Trynka offers new revelations and sets straight the tall tales that have long marred
Jones
's legacy. A gripping battle between creativity and ambition, between self-sabotage and betrayal. It's all here: the girlfriends, the drugs, and some of the greatest music of all time. Victors get to write history, but it's rarely fully true. The complete, magnificent story of the
Rolling
Stones
can never be told until we disentangle all the threads and put
Brian
Jones
back in the foreground"--Provided by publisher.
